首先說說什麼是程序化交易中的滑點。www.emoneybtc.com我眼中程序化交易中的滑點就是,你的期望價格與實際成交價格之間的點差。可以給出一個滑點的計算公式:滑點=行情tick級別波動速度*網絡延遲時間。
由於行情永遠是波動的,所以行情並不是產生滑點的原因。而在歷史回測和模擬盤中,由於沒有任何網絡延遲時間,所以就不會產生滑點(但此時行情波動依然,但是沒有滑點),你可以在模擬盤中,對每一張單子設定止盈止損,你會發現,每筆都是按照你期望的價格激發止盈或者止損的。
按照上述計算公式,行情的波動,你是無法左右的,但是網絡延遲時間,卻是你可以把控的。一定要清楚,你在你電腦上看到的行情,是重播而不是直播,而程序根據這一行情下發的指令,中間也需要傳遞的時間,才能生效。所以行情波動速度大以及網絡延遲嚴重,會加大滑點的影響。而這一影響,其實對小周期交易級別甚至會產生顛覆性的結果。
規避滑點的影響,可以采取以下三條道路:
1、加大程序化交易的級別
在程序化交易的過程中,大周期的交易級別,其平均盈利點數和虧損點數必然大於小的交易級別。如果一個大級別的模型是平均盈利50點,平均虧損30點,而小級別是平均盈利5點,平均虧損3點,在歷史回測和模擬盤中,兩者看不出什麼大的區別,都是可以取得穩定盈利的模型,但是實盤中,就會截然不同,前者一定比後者有效的多,因為滑點的尺度,和平均盈虧點數,不在一個數量級。
2、降低程序化交易過程中的網絡延遲
采取一切辦法,尋找連接你程序化交易服務器最快的途徑,降低網絡延時。
3、規避特定的行情波動速度快的時間點
比如有的人對非農,采取完全規避的做法,數據公布前15分鐘全部清倉。行情的波動速度,你是無法左右的,但是惹不起可以躲得起,非農公布時間,精確到秒,此時不持倉,那滑點再大,對你也毫無影響。
綜上,2和3是對計算公式兩個乘數進行調整而降低或者規避程序化交易中的滑點,而方法一,其實並不降低滑點,只是使得降低滑點的影響效果,使其不影響你的收益率曲線。最後說一點,程序化交易中的滑點有的時候還可以增加你的收益,這需要你去理解你開單和平倉的方式,一句話,如果你開單方式是逆tick級別的勢,那滑點對你有利,如果你平倉方式是順tick級別的勢,滑點也對你有利,此時,你的網絡延遲較大,其實是好事!
比如回踩方式的下單,還有固定點數的止盈,滑點都是你的朋友。當你有兩個以上的交易主機的時候,就需要對所有的下單和平倉進行甄別,如果滑點對你有利,則這些指令放到慢速網絡主機上去操作,如果滑點對你不利,則要將這些指令拆分到快速網絡主機去操作。
2018年6月2日,“新加坡區塊鏈行業發展系列研討會”第一期,“交易所項目篩選與區塊鏈行業發展研討會——暨 Bplus 與全球頂級交易所戰
據了解,俄羅斯非銀行信貸組織專家委員會提出了一項提案,允許該國的農村企業獲得加密貸款以吸引海外資金。該委員會主席要求農村信用合作社研究和教
區塊鏈除了作為“比特幣”出現以外,其技術特性可以用在許多領域,在航空領域中也有很大的應用潛力。 從 2008 年美籍日裔物理學家中本
首先,很多人說,區塊鏈是個分布式賬本,但實際上,分布式賬本本質上是通過區塊鏈的共識基礎來構建的一個應用。如同比特幣實現了轉賬,但更重要的是
提起區塊鏈,您首先會想到什麼?是以比特幣為代表的虛擬貨幣,還是跨境支付中的點對點交易?作為一種數字技術,率先在金融領域落地的區塊鏈,已延伸
很多股民朋友在操作中一看到K線圖中出現了雙頂形態,就下意識地認為是出現了賣出信號。其實,這種理解是很片面的,雙頂可以出現在不同的位
基本信息 景順長城景豐貨幣B,基金代碼是000707。集中認購時間為9.09-9.12。基金托管方為興業銀行,管理人
外_匯_邦 WaiHuiBang.com 現在我來講一講資金的管理。以很多很多人的經驗來說,這是最主要的一項交易技術。記得我上次跟大家提過的
最佳答案: 淘寶轉賣閒魚發貨方法如下:1、打開閒魚app在首頁底部欄找到“我的”-點擊“我賣出的”
最佳答案: 可以。不過微信還信用卡也要收0.1%的手續費,最低0.1元。為本人還款,單筆限額5萬元,